例如,API响应是: "测试":{ " Test1":390, " Test2":" 391" }
我只想检查Test1返回的整数值和Test2是否返回字符串值而不验证字段返回的实际值(例如:390)。
答案 0 :(得分:1)
isNaN
返回true。 (即你想从isNaN得到假)
var obj = { val: 12345 };
console.log(!isNaN(obj.val)); // true. its integer
答案 1 :(得分:0)
你可以使用typeof(),即:
var montexte="montexte"
var monchiffre=50
console.log('texte ? ' + typeof(montexte)) // gives string
console.log('chiffre ? ' + typeof(monchiffre)) // gives number
希望这会有所帮助